PHP Roles in Management Information Systems (MIS)

PHP developer roles within Management Information Systems (MIS) involve creating and maintaining the software systems that businesses use to collect, process, and present data for decision-making. These positions merge strong PHP programming skills with a solid understanding of business operations and data management. Developers in this field build the backbone of a company's internal data infrastructure, from custom CRMs to financial reporting dashboards.

Core Focus Areas in MIS Development

The primary goal of an MIS developer is to build applications that turn raw data into actionable insights. This includes developing internal tools to streamline business processes, integrating various data sources via APIs, and creating comprehensive dashboards for management. Projects often involve building custom Enterprise Resource Planning (ERP) modules, automating data entry and validation, and designing databases that accurately model business workflows.

Required Technical and Business Skills

A successful developer in MIS needs a hybrid skill set that bridges technology and business. On the technical side, expertise in PHP, modern frameworks like Laravel or Symfony, and advanced SQL is essential. Equally important skills include:

  • Strong database design and data modeling capabilities.
  • Experience with data integration and building ETL (Extract, Transform, Load) processes.
  • Knowledge of business intelligence (BI) concepts and data visualization tools.
  • The ability to analyze business requirements and translate them into technical specifications.
  • Familiarity with financial, sales, or operational business domains.
Your experience on this site will be improved by allowing cookies Cookie Policy